Specifications
Polarization: Polar
Package / Case: Radial, Can - Snap-In
Mounting Type: Through Hole
Surface Mount Land Size: --
Height - Seated (Max): 1.772" (45.00mm)
Size / Dimension: 0.984" Dia (25.00mm)
Lead Spacing: 0.394" (10.00mm)
Ripple Current @ High Frequency: 3.732A @ 100kHz
Ripple Current @ Low Frequency: 3.11A @ 120Hz
Applications: General Purpose
Ratings: --
Series: LPW
Operating Temperature: -40°C ~ 85°C
Lifetime @ Temp.: 1000 Hrs @ 85°C
ESR (Equivalent Series Resistance): 106 mOhm @ 120Hz
Voltage - Rated: 63V
Tolerance: ±20%
Capacitance: 4700µF
Moisture Sensitivity Level (MSL): --
Part Status: Obsolete
Lead Free Status / RoHS Status: --
Packaging: Bulk
